Forté Accelerates Translation of Agent and Free Agent

In our Agent 1.9 User Survey we asked the Agent Community whether we should translate Agent into languages other than English.

The response was overwhelming. 25% of our users requested another language with German being the most common. But the really amazing part was that 33% of the users polled (nearly 1000 users) were willing to participate in the process. See the full results of our Translation Survey.

This could only happen on Usenet.

The icing on the cake is that independant groups within the Agent Community have already translated Agent into German, French, Spanish, and Italian by extracting text resources from the Agent EXE! This kind of initiative must be rewarded.

Currently, our Product Road Map shows translations as part of Agent 2.1. We wanted to create a nice clean toolkit. However, the Agent Community doesn't want to wait that long, so Chris Beck is going to formalize the formation of international collaboration teams and document the process for translating version 1.92 of Agent and Free Agent.

Once again the Agent Community steers us in the right direction.
